Information Collection Request

Title: United States Coast Guard Academy Application and Supplemental Forms.

OMB Control Number: 1625-0004.

Summary: Any person who wishes to compete for an appointment as a Coast Guard Cadet must fill out a preliminary application and supplemental forms.

Need: 14 U.S.C. 182 authorizes the Secretary to ensure that qualified people have every opportunity to compete for appointments as cadets at the U.S. Coast Guard Academy.

Respondents: Individuals or household.

Frequency: Once.

Burden: The estimated burden is 8,300 hours a year.
